About Harrison
Hey there! I’m Harrison — a soon-to-be university graduate who’s as passionate about English as I am about football (I even played for Crystal Palace’s youth team, so you know I’ve got dedication!). I never scored lower than a B in any of my GCSEs, including A* grades in both English Literature and Language. At A-level, I studied English Literature, History, and Sport, and even completed an EPQ on why rap lyrics deserve a spot in GCSE poetry studies — because why shouldn’t Shakespeare share the stage with hip-hop? When I’m not coaching words into shape, you’ll find me jamming on my guitar (fair warning: I’m better at teaching than playing!), binge-watching films and cartoons, or nerding out over superhero comics and Star Wars. With a calm and friendly approach, I make learning English fun and confidence-boosting, tailored to each student’s style. So, if you want an English tutor who’s as good with Shakespeare as I am with a football, and who believes learning should be enjoyable (and maybe a little nerdy), I’m your guy!

My Approach to Tutoring I believe that learning English should be enjoyable and build confidence. My teaching style is calm, patient, and tailored to each child’s unique needs and pace. Drawing on my experience coaching children in sports, I know how important encouragement and positive reinforcement are for progress. I also use effective techniques learnt from my mother, who works with SEN children. This has helped me develop personalised methods that support different learning styles, making lessons accessible and fun. Typically, lessons last 45–60 minutes — long enough to focus but short enough to keep attention sharp. I cover everything from phonics and spelling to reading comprehension, creative writing, and exam prep. I tutor children aged 7–16, from beginners to GCSE level, helping them build not only skills but a genuine love for English.
